Q1MCQ20251 mark

Which one of the following statements is NOT correct?

(A)The molecules of soap are sodium or potassium salts of long chain fatty acids
(B)The molecules of soap contain both hydrophobic and hydrophilic ends
(C)Detergents are more effective than soaps in hard water
(D)In micelles the ionic-end of the molecules is towards oil droplet while the other end faces outside✓ Correct

Q3MCQ20251 mark

Which one of the following particles in the nucleus of an atom was discovered by J. Chadwick?

(A)Electron
(B)Proton
(C)Positron
(D)Neutron✓ Correct
Q4MCQ20251 mark

Which one of the following findings is NOT observed in Rutherford's Nuclear Model of Atom?

(A)There is a neutral centre in an atom called nucleus✓ Correct
(B)Nearly all the mass of an atom resides in the nucleus
(C)The electrons revolve around the nucleus in a circular path
(D)The size of a nucleus is very small as compared to the size of atom

Q8MCQ20251 mark

Which one of the following statements about a compound is NOT correct?

(A)A compound is a substance composed of two or more elements, chemically combined in a fixed proportion
(B)Properties of a compound are different from its constituent elements
(C)A compound is an impure substance✓ Correct
(D)The constituents of a compound can be separated only by chemical or electrochemical reactions
